    Abstract: A device and system are disclosed to clean the interior of tubes in air-cooled heat exchangers. The device is attached at each end of a tube by electromagnetism; either directly to a ferromagnetic tube header, or to a ferromagnetic plate secured to a non-ferromagnetic plug-type header or to a plate-type header of any metal. High pressure air with entrained dry finely-divided abrasive is conducted through a nozzle supported by the device. At the other end of the tube, another device supports a nozzle that captures the air, spent abrasive, and removed material. Spent abrasive and removed material are separated by filtration from the air before the air is exhausted to the environment. Tubes are cleaned to a bright metal condition, suitable for inspection or application of a corrosion-resistant coating, or to a lesser level of cleanliness appropriate for return to service.

    Abstract: A device, system, and method is disclosed for cleaning the interior of the tubes in air-cooled heat exchangers. The tubes are cleaned using dry finely divided abrasive entrained in high pressure air blasted through the tube to remove any accumulation in the tube or on the tube walls resulting in a bright metal condition suitable for inspection by the Internal Rotary Inspection System, or application of a corrosion-resistant coating, or a lesser level of cleanliness appropriate for return to service. The device is electromagnetically attached to the outside of a ferromagnetic tube header, or to a ferromagnetic plate secured to the outside of a non-ferromagnetic plug-type header or a plate-type header of any material, to temporarily secure a grit-resistant nozzle assembly and position the nozzle for proper application of the high pressure air and entrained abrasive to facilitate cleaning, avoid tube damage, and provide for operator safety.

    Abstract: A system and method may include a device, e.g., a cellular telephone, and a server providing for remotely updating display pages of the device. The server may: provide for display of a webpage including a first section having a visual replication of a display page of the device and a second section including a plurality of graphical objects, the webpage including interactive functionality for modification of the visual replication in response to a drag-and-drop operation of one of the plurality of graphical objects to a position in the visual replication; and, responsive to receipt of an instruction to permanently set the modification, transmit a synchronization message to the device indicating an association of the one of the plurality of graphical objects with the position. In accordance with the synchronization message, the device may update a data store used by the device for generating the display page.
